Q:I asked this yesterday and did not really receive an answer so I'm going to ask it in a different way. I was laid off in December and informed by my employer, that I would be receiving Cobra, however I never got the paperwork. It's now been over 60 days so I am wondering if it's too late to apply and if not where can I get the correct paperwork. Please let me know as soon as you can. Thank you so much.
A:When you lost your job if there was 20 or more employees Cobra may have been an option.By law your employer had 45 days to send you information regarding the Cobra.If you never received the paper work you need to contact your employer to see if you are still eligible or if because the 60 day period has passed if you can no longer enroll.
